OperaTutorial de sistem

OperaTutorial System (OS) Rezumat


Aceasta Operating System Tutorial oferฤƒ toate conceptele de bazฤƒ ศ™i avansate ale Operating System. Acest OperaCursul ting System este conceput pentru รฎncepฤƒtori, profesioniศ™ti ศ™i, de asemenea, aspiranศ›i GATE pentru pregฤƒtirea lor pentru examen. Acest tutorial vฤƒ va oferi cunoศ™tinศ›e profunde despre fiecare OperaConceptul de sistem. In acest OperaรŽn tutorialul de dezvoltare a sistemului, conศ›inutul este descris รฎn detaliu ศ™i vฤƒ va rezolva toate รฎntrebฤƒrile referitoare la sistemul de operare.

Ce este un sistem de operare?


An Operating System (OS) este un software care acศ›ioneazฤƒ ca o interfaศ›ฤƒ รฎntre utilizatorul final ศ™i hardware-ul computerului. Fiecare computer trebuie sฤƒ aibฤƒ cel puศ›in un sistem de operare pentru a rula alte programe software ศ™i aplicaศ›ii precum MS Word, Chrome, Jocuri etc.

Ce ar trebui sฤƒ ศ™tiu?


Nimic! Acest tutorial pentru elementele de bazฤƒ ale OperaSistemul de tingere este conceput pentru รฎncepฤƒtorii absoluti.

๐Ÿ‘‰ Descฤƒrcaศ›i OperaTutorialul sistemului ting รฎn format PDF

OperaPrograma de programare a sistemului de operare (OS).

Introducere

๐Ÿ‘ Lesspe 1 Ce Este Operating System? โ€” Explicaศ›i tipurile de sisteme de operare, caracteristici ศ™i exemple
๐Ÿ‘ Lesspe 2 Ce Este Semaphore? โ€” Binar, Numฤƒrarea Tipurilor cu Exemplu
๐Ÿ‘ Lesspe 3 Componente ale Operating Systems โ€” Explicaศ›i componentele sistemului de operare

Lucruri avansate

๐Ÿ‘ Lesspe 1 Microkernel in Operating System - Architecturฤƒ, Avantaje
๐Ÿ‘ Lesspe 2 Apel de sistem รฎn sistemul de operare โ€” Tipuri ศ™i exemple
๐Ÿ‘ Lesspe 3 Sisteme de fiศ™iere รฎn Operating System โ€” Structurฤƒ, Atribute, Tip
๐Ÿ‘ Lesspe 4 Sistem de operare รฎn timp real (RTOS) โ€” Componente, Tipuri, Exemple
๐Ÿ‘ Lesspe 5 Protocolul RPC (Remote Procedure Call). โ€” Ce este, Tipuri, Caracteristici, Avantaje
๐Ÿ‘ Lesspe 6 Programarea CPU โ€” Programarea CPU Algorithms in Operating Systems
๐Ÿ‘ Lesspe 7 Managementul proceselor รฎn Operating System โ€” PCB รฎn sistemul de operare
๐Ÿ‘ Lesspe 8 Blocaj รฎn impas Operating System โ€” Introducere รฎn DEADLOCK รฎn sistemul de operare
๐Ÿ‘ Lesspe 9 Algoritmul de programare FCFS โ€” Ce este, exemplu de program
๐Ÿ‘ Lesspe 10 Paging in Operating System โ€” OS Paging cu Exemplu
๐Ÿ‘ Lesspe 11 livelock โ€” Care este, exemplu, diferenศ›a cu Deadlock
๐Ÿ‘ Lesspe 12 Comunicare รฎntre procese (IPC) โ€” Ce este comunicarea รฎntre procese?
๐Ÿ‘ Lesspe 13 Algoritmul de programare Round Robin โ€” รŽnvaศ›ฤƒ cu exemplu
๐Ÿ‘ Lesspe 14 Proces Synchronizare โ€” Problemฤƒ secศ›iune criticฤƒ รฎn sistemul de operare
๐Ÿ‘ Lesspe 15 Programarea proceselor โ€” Programator pe termen lung, mediu ศ™i scurt
๐Ÿ‘ Lesspe 16 Algoritmul de programare prioritarฤƒ โ€” Preemptive, Non-Preemptive EXEMPLU
๐Ÿ‘ Lesspe 17 Managementul memoriei รฎn sistemul de operare โ€” Contigu, Schimbare, Fragmentare
๐Ÿ‘ Lesspe 18 Cel mai scurt job mai รฎntรขi (SJF) โ€” Exemplu preventiv, non-preemptiv
๐Ÿ‘ Lesspe 19 Memoria virtualฤƒ รฎn sistemul de operare โ€” Ce este, Paginฤƒ la cerere, Avantaje
๐Ÿ‘ Lesspe 20 Algoritmul bancherului รฎn Operating System โ€” Ce este algoritmul lui Banker?

Cunoaศ™teศ›i diferenศ›ele

๐Ÿ‘ Lesspe 1 Mutex vs Semaphore - Care este diferenศ›a?
๐Ÿ‘ Lesspe 2 Proces vs Thread - Care este diferenศ›a?
๐Ÿ‘ Lesspe 3 Tipuri de RAM (Memorie cu acces aleatoriu) โ€” Diferite tipuri de RAM explicate
๐Ÿ‘ Lesspe 4 RAM vs ROM - Care este diferenศ›a?
๐Ÿ‘ Lesspe 5 DDR3 vs DDR4 โ€” Trebuie sฤƒ cunoaศ™teศ›i diferenศ›ele
๐Ÿ‘ Lesspe 6 Multithreading vs Multiprocesare - Care este diferenศ›a?
๐Ÿ‘ Lesspe 7 Microprocesor ศ™i microcontroler - Care este diferenศ›a?
๐Ÿ‘ Lesspe 8 Programare preventivฤƒ vs non-preemptivฤƒ โ€” Diferenศ›ele cheie
๐Ÿ‘ Lesspe 9 Paginare vs segmentare โ€” Diferenศ›ele cheie
๐Ÿ‘ Lesspe 10 Software pentru fiศ™iere Zip โ€” Cele mai bune 20 de programe de fiศ™iere Zip | Dezarhivaศ›i programul | Comprimarea fiศ™ierelor
๐Ÿ‘ Lesspe 11 Alternative Winzip โ€” 15 cele mai bune alternative gratuite Winzip (software de fiศ™iere ZIP)
๐Ÿ‘ Lesspe 12 CEL MAI BUN Operating Systems โ€” 8 CELE MAI BUN Operating Systems

Trebuie ศ™tiut!

๐Ÿ‘ Lesspe 1 Operating System Interviu รŽntrebฤƒri โ€” รŽntrebฤƒri ศ™i rฤƒspunsuri la interviul pentru cei mai buni 50 de ingineri de sisteme de operare
๐Ÿ‘ Lesspe 2 รŽntrebฤƒri la interviu pentru inginer de asistenศ›ฤƒ desktop โ€” รŽntrebฤƒri ศ™i rฤƒspunsuri la interviul pentru Top 50 de ingineri de asistenศ›ฤƒ desktop
๐Ÿ‘ Lesspe 3 OperaTest de sistem - OperaSistemul MCQ (รฎntrebฤƒri cu alegere multiplฤƒ)

De ce sฤƒ รฎnveศ›i Operating Systems?

Iata care sunt motivele invatarii Operasisteme de alimentare:

  • Vฤƒ permite sฤƒ ascundeศ›i detaliile hardware prin crearea unei abstracศ›iuni
  • Uศ™or de utilizat cu o interfaศ›ฤƒ graficฤƒ
  • Oferฤƒ un mediu รฎn care un utilizator poate executa programe ศ™i aplicaศ›ii
  • Operating System acศ›ioneazฤƒ ca un intermediar รฎntre aplicaศ›ii ศ™i componentele hardware
  • Oferฤƒ resursele sistemului informatic รฎn formate uศ™or de utilizat

Care sunt aplicaศ›iile Operating System?

Urmฤƒtoarele sunt cรขteva dintre activitฤƒศ›ile importante pe care an OperaSistemul de ting efectueazฤƒ:

  • De securitate: OperaSistemul de operare previne accesul neautorizat la programe ศ™i date.
  • Controleazฤƒ performanศ›a unui sistem: รŽnregistrarea รฎntรขrzierilor dintre o solicitare pentru un serviciu ศ™i rฤƒspunsul din partea sistemului.
  • Contabilitatea postului: Puteศ›i urmฤƒri timpul ศ™i resursele.
  • Ajutoare la detectarea erorilor: Sistemul de operare ajutฤƒ la urmฤƒrirea mesajelor de eroare ศ™i a altor instrumente de depanare ศ™i de detectare a erorilor.
  • Ajutฤƒ la coordonarea รฎntre alte programe: Coordonarea ศ™i atribuirea compilatorilor, interpreศ›ilor, asamblatorilor ศ™i a altor software-uri.

Caracteristicile OperaSistem de tingere:

Iatฤƒ o listฤƒ cu caracteristicile importante รฎntรขlnite frecvent ale unui OperaSistem de tingere:

  • Mod protejat ศ™i supervizor
  • Permite accesul la disc ศ™i securitatea รฎn reศ›ea a driverelor de dispozitiv ale sistemelor de fiศ™iere
  • Execuศ›ia programului
  • Managementul memoriei
  • Gestionarea operaศ›iunilor I/O
  • Manipularea sistemului de fiศ™iere
  • Detectarea ศ™i tratarea erorilor
  • Alocare resurselor
  • Protecศ›ia informaศ›iilor ศ™i a resurselor

Ce veศ›i รฎnvฤƒศ›a รฎn acest tutorial OS?

รŽn acest OperaรŽn tutorialul sistemului, veศ›i รฎnvฤƒศ›a conceptul sistemului de operare, tipurile de sisteme de operare, sistemele de operare รฎn timp real, paginarea, metodele de programare (SJF, Round robin), apelurile de sistem รฎn sistemul de operare, algoritmul Banker, Livelock ศ™i mecanismul de blocare.

Existฤƒ cerinศ›e prealabile pentru acest tutorial de sistem de operare?

Acest tutorial OS a fost pregฤƒtit pentru รฎncepฤƒtori absoluti. รŽi ajutฤƒ sฤƒ รฎnศ›eleagฤƒ conceptele de bazฤƒ pรขnฤƒ la avansate ศ™i intermediare legate de Operating System. Cu toate acestea, รฎnainte de a รฎnvฤƒศ›a acest tutorial de sistem de operare, este de preferat sฤƒ cunoaศ™teศ›i conceptele fundamentale ale computerului, cum ar fi tastatura, mouse-ul, monitorul, intrare-ieศ™ire, memoria primarฤƒ (RAM), memoria secundarฤƒ (ROM), etc.

Cine ar trebui sฤƒ รฎnveศ›e Operating System?

Acest tutorial privind sistemul de operare este conceput pentru a ajuta atรขt รฎncepฤƒtorii, cรขt ศ™i profesioniศ™tii. Dupฤƒ ce aศ›i รฎnvฤƒศ›at sistemul de operare, puteศ›i explora oportunitฤƒศ›i de angajare ศ™i carierฤƒ ca ศ™i Operaanalist de sisteme, Operaprogramator de sisteme. Acest tutorial de sistem de operare este, de asemenea, conceput pentru a ajuta aspiranศ›ii GATE pentru pregฤƒtirea examenului ศ™i util pentru examene precum NTA UGC NET Computer Science and Applications.

Rezumaศ›i aceastฤƒ postare cu: